ดูกระบวนการที่กำลังทำงานอยู่ในพื้นหลังของ iOS

iOS ไม่มีโปรแกรมการตรวจสอบกิจกรรมหรือตัวจัดการงานที่ Mac เครื่องเดสก์ท็อปทำใน OS X แต่ถ้าคุณต้องการดูว่าปพลิเคชันและกระบวนการใดที่ทำงานอยู่เบื้องหลัง iPhone, iPad หรือ iPod touch คุณสามารถทำได้ ดังนั้นการใช้วิธีการที่แตกต่างกันไม่กี่ สำหรับผู้ใช้ส่วนใหญ่เพียงแค่แสดงแถบมัลติทาสกิ้งก็เพียงพอแล้ว แต่คนที่อยากรู้อยากเห็นยังสามารถเปิดเผยกระบวนการระดับระบบโดยใช้วิธีอื่นร่วมกับแอปของบุคคลที่สามหรือสำหรับผู้ใช้ที่มีอุปกรณ์ jailbroken บรรทัดคำสั่ง

1: ตัวจัดการงานพื้นฐานของ iOS

ผู้ใช้ iOS ทุกคนอาจทราบถึงตัวจัดการงานโดยเดี๋ยวนี้ซึ่งสามารถเข้าถึงได้ด้วยการคลิกสองครั้งที่ปุ่มโฮม แถวไอคอนด้านล่างแสดงว่าแอปใดกำลังทำงานในพื้นหลังและคุณสามารถพลิกซ้ายหรือขวาเพื่อดูเพิ่มเติมได้

ผู้จัดการงานจะแสดงเฉพาะแอปพลิเคชันเท่านั้นและถ้าคุณหวังว่าจะมีบางอย่างที่เฉพาะเจาะจงมากขึ้นหรือเป็นเทคนิคคุณจะต้องหันไปใช้โซลูชันอื่นจากบุคคลที่สาม

2: ใช้ App กระบวนการเช่น DeviceStats

DeviceStats เป็นแอปฟรีของบุคคลที่สามซึ่งอาจไม่ใช่สิ่งที่ดีที่สุดในโลก แต่ทำงานเพื่อแสดงให้คุณเห็นว่ากระบวนการใดกำลังทำงานอยู่เบื้องหลังอุปกรณ์ iOS รวมถึง daemons และงานพื้นหลัง

  • คว้า DeviceStats จาก App Store

การเปิดตัว DeviceStats บน iPad iPhone หรือ iPod touch จะแสดงแท็บและตัวเลือกต่างๆ แต่สิ่งที่เราสนใจคือแท็บ "Processes" ซึ่งจะมีป้ายสีแดงอยู่เพื่อระบุจำนวนกระบวนการทั้งหมด วิ่ง.

การเลื่อนผ่านรายการควรเปิดเผยชื่อแอปที่คุ้นเคยบางอย่างที่คุณเปิดไว้เช่น Camera, Calculator, Videos, Photos, Preferences, Music ฯลฯ และจะมีหลายงานที่แสดงว่าเป็นกระบวนการพื้นหลังงานระบบและ daemons .

ไม่มีสิ่งใดที่แสดงอยู่ใน DeviceStats สามารถดำเนินการได้โดยตรงผ่านแอปเองซึ่งหมายความว่าแม้ว่าคุณจะระบุกระบวนการที่คุณไม่สามารถทำอะไรได้บ้างเว้นแต่จะเป็นแอปพลิเคชันมาตรฐาน ปพลิเคชันมาตรฐานสามารถออกได้ตามปกติหรือถูกฆ่าตาย (บังคับให้ลาออก) ผ่านมาตรการโดยตรง ไม่มีทางที่จะฆ่าหรือออกจาก daemons พื้นหลังและงานที่ทำงานภายใน iOS อย่างไรก็ตาม

3: ใช้ 'ด้านบน' หรือ 'ps aux' จาก Command Line - Jailbreak Only

ผู้ใช้ที่ได้รับการ jailbroken อุปกรณ์ iOS สามารถเข้าถึงบรรทัดคำสั่งได้โดยตรงโดยใช้แอปเช่น MobileTerminal หรือโดยการเชื่อมต่อโดยตรงกับอุปกรณ์ผ่านทาง SSH

เมื่อเชื่อมต่อผ่านบรรทัดคำสั่งคุณสามารถใช้ 'ด้านบน' หรือ 'ps aux' เพื่อดูกระบวนการที่ใช้งานอยู่ทั้งหมด "ด้านบน" จะแสดงรายการกระบวนการอัปเดตที่สดใหม่ขณะที่ 'ps aux' จะพิมพ์ภาพรวมของกระบวนการทั้งหมดและ daemons แต่ไม่อัพเดตซีพียูที่ใช้งานอยู่หรือการใช้หน่วยความจำ กระบวนการที่ได้รับการระบุโดย ps หรือด้านบนสามารถถูกฆ่าโดยตรงผ่านบรรทัดคำสั่ง แต่อาจมีผลกระทบที่ไม่ได้ตั้งใจสำหรับ iPad, iPhone หรือ iPod touch และทำให้มันแข็งขึ้นหรือล้มเหลวต้องรีบูตอุปกรณ์ อีกครั้งนี้สามารถเข้าถึงได้ผ่านอุปกรณ์ jailbroken เท่านั้นซึ่งจะทำให้ตัวเลือกนี้มีข้อ จำกัด ค่อนข้าง จำกัด